Defining Your Webinar Goals

Before diving headfirst into planning your content, let’s clarify what you want to achieve. Setting clear goals is crucial. Are you aiming for lead generation, brand awareness, or simply sharing your expertise? Defining specific, measurable goals can set the tone for everything that follows.

  • Goal-oriented planning: Determine what success looks like for you. If you’re focused on lead generation, aim for a specific number of sign-ups or attendees.
  • Audience alignment: Ensure your goals resonate with what your target audience craves. You wouldn’t throw a surf party on an ice rink, right?

Crafting Compelling Webinar Content

Now, onto the fun part—content! A webinar isn’t just about sharing slides; it’s about telling a story. Effective content should have a rhythm, weaving in storytelling, relatable examples, and interactive elements that keep folks on the edge of their seats.

Here are some best practices:

  • Start with a hook: Grab your audience’s attention right away. A thought-provoking question or a surprising fact can be a great opener.
  • Make it interactive: Polls, Q&A sessions, and breakout discussions aren’t just fluff—they’re essential for audience engagement. Get your attendees to participate, and you’ll keep the energy high!

Selecting the Right Webinar Tools and Software

Your choice of webinar platform can make or break the experience. With so many options out there—Zoom, GoToWebinar, WebinarJam, just to name a few—it’s essential to weigh the pros and cons of each.

Consider what features matter most to you:

  • User interface: Is it easy to navigate for both you and your audience?
  • Quality: Check for audio/video quality—nobody wants to miss your golden nuggets because of poor sound!
  • Support: Opt for tools that offer solid customer support—you’ll appreciate it when things go awry (and they sometimes will).

Effectively Promoting Your Webinar

Once you’ve got your content and tools lined up, it’s time to spread the word! Crafting compelling invitations is key. Get creative with your email invites and social media posts. Use eye-catching graphics and actionable language that makes people feel they can’t miss out.

And why not leverage influencers and partners? Collaborations can amplify your reach, giving your webinar a credibility boost. It’s like a high-five from industry leaders!

Keeping Your Audience Engaged During the Webinar

So, the big day has finally arrived! Now’s the time to keep that energy buzzing. Here are some techniques to ensure your audience remains engaged:

  • Active participation: Use live chat to keep the conversation flowing. Encourage questions throughout, not just at the end.
  • Reading the room: Pay attention to your audience's reactions—if they seem distracted, try shifting gears. A timely joke or a surprise poll can re-energize the group.

Turning Webinar Attendees into Customers

Now, let’s talk about the brass tacks: converting those attendees into customers. It doesn’t stop at saying goodbye after the webinar ends. Effective follow-up is crucial.

Send personalized thank-you emails and include links to resources or special offers. Keep the conversation going! It’s all about nurturing those leads until they’re ready to make a purchase.

Oh, and don’t forget to measure your success. Analyze your webinar metrics—attendance rates, engagement levels, conversion rates. These insights will help refine your future webinars and ensure even better results down the line.
